Vehicle Drying Agents Market size was valued at USD 1.5 Billion in 2022 and is projected to reach USD 2.8 Billion by 2030, growing at a CAGR of 8.5% from 2024 to 2030.
The global vehicle drying agents market is witnessing substantial growth due to the increasing demand for advanced cleaning and maintenance solutions for vehicles. These agents are essential in reducing the drying time of vehicles after washing, helping prevent water spots, corrosion, and other issues related to moisture. Their application across various vehicle segments, such as commercial and passenger vehicles, plays a crucial role in maintaining the aesthetic and functional quality of the vehicles. As technology continues to advance, the vehicle drying agents market is poised to expand further, fueled by innovations in agent formulations and increasing awareness regarding vehicle maintenance.

The vehicle drying agents market is segmented by application into two primary subsegments: commercial vehicles and passenger vehicles. Each of these segments has unique characteristics, reflecting the specific requirements of the respective vehicle types. Below, we explore these segments in detail:
Commercial vehicles, including trucks, buses, and delivery vehicles, are vital to the transportation and logistics industries. These vehicles are often exposed to harsh environmental conditions, such as dirt, grime, and industrial pollutants, which necessitate frequent cleaning and maintenance. The application of vehicle drying agents in the commercial vehicle segment is designed to improve the efficiency of the washing process and ensure that these large vehicles remain in optimal condition. Drying agents help to speed up the drying process, reducing downtime and allowing these vehicles to return to operation quickly. Moreover, they help prevent watermarks and potential rust formation, which are crucial in preserving the structural integrity and appearance of the vehicles over time.
As commercial vehicles are often in continuous use, vehicle owners and fleet managers are increasingly turning to advanced drying agents that provide durable and long-lasting protection. These agents are designed to be highly effective on large surfaces, ensuring that even hard-to-reach areas dry quickly and thoroughly. With the growing emphasis on fleet management and operational efficiency, the demand for commercial vehicle drying agents is expected to rise significantly, contributing to the overall expansion of the market. Furthermore, commercial vehicles, particularly those used in industries such as construction, logistics, and public transportation, often require robust cleaning solutions to maintain their functional performance, making the role of drying agents even more crucial.
Passenger vehicles, such as cars, SUVs, and motorcycles, make up a significant portion of the vehicle drying agents market. The application of drying agents in this segment is primarily driven by the desire for enhanced vehicle appearance and protection. Car owners are increasingly aware of the need to maintain the aesthetic appeal of their vehicles, and drying agents play a vital role in preventing water spots, streaks, and other imperfections that may arise during the drying process. These agents ensure that the vehicle’s exterior remains smooth, shiny, and free from blemishes, contributing to a more polished and well-maintained appearance.
Additionally, the growing consumer preference for high-performance and eco-friendly vehicle cleaning products has led to an increased demand for specialized drying agents that are safe for both the vehicle and the environment. Passenger vehicle owners are particularly focused on products that reduce drying time while offering protection against the harmful effects of prolonged exposure to water. This includes safeguarding the paint and other delicate components from potential damage. As the trend toward sustainability continues to gain momentum, the market for eco-friendly vehicle drying agents for passenger vehicles is anticipated to experience significant growth, driven by both consumer demand and regulatory pressures for environmentally responsible products.

1. What are vehicle drying agents?
Vehicle drying agents are products designed to help vehicles dry faster and more efficiently after washing, reducing water spots and streaks on the surface.
2. Why are vehicle drying agents important?
They are important because they prevent water spots, streaks, and corrosion, keeping the vehicle looking clean and well-maintained.
3. Are vehicle drying agents safe for the environment?
Yes, many vehicle drying agents are formulated to be eco-friendly and biodegradable, reducing their environmental impact.
4. How do drying agents speed up the drying process?
Drying agents work by reducing the surface tension of water, allowing it to evaporate more quickly and evenly from the vehicle’s surface.
5. Can drying agents be used on all types of vehicles?
Yes, drying agents are designed to be safe and effective for use on both commercial and passenger vehicles.
